Grasping Irrigation: Methods and Benefits
Irrigation plays a crucial role in agriculture by supplying water to crops. There are various techniques of irrigation, each with its specific advantages and disadvantages. Some common techniques include basin irrigation, where water covers over the entire field; trickle irrigation, which delivers water directly to the plant roots; and sprinkler irrigation, where water is dispersed through the air.
Each irrigation approach has its unique benefits. For example, drip irrigation is highly productive as it minimizes water loss. Surface irrigation can be a cost-effective alternative for large fields, while sprinkler irrigation is suitable for various types of crops.
The benefits of irrigation are manifold. It enhances crop yields by providing a reliable water supply, even during dry periods. Irrigation also allows the cultivation of crops in areas with low rainfall or where water is scarce. Moreover, irrigation can improve soil fertility by leaching out salts and providing a suitable environment for plant growth. here
By understanding different irrigation methods and their benefits, farmers can make strategic decisions about how to best utilize water resources for optimal crop production.

Modern Innovations in Irrigation Technology
The field of irrigation is evolving at a remarkable pace, with a plethora latest innovations created to optimize water usage and enhance crop yields. From sophisticated sensors that monitor soil moisture levels in real-time to controlled irrigation systems, these developments are revolutionizing the way we supply crops. One significant innovation is the use of subsurface drip lines, which deliver water directly to plant roots, minimizing water waste and increasing efficiency. Additionally, drones equipped with cameras are being applied to analyze irrigation needs and provide valuable data for agriculturalists. These revolutionary advancements in irrigation technology are helping to a environmentally friendly agricultural future.
